Abstract

The invention relates to the technical field of artificial intelligence and computers and particularly relates to a brain mapping-based event judgment method, a brain mapping-based event judgment device, a storage medium and an electronic device. The method can comprise the steps of constructing a plurality of boxes for mapping cerebral cortical columns; according to the plurality of boxes, constructing a multi-layer pool for mapping a brain function identification area; constructing a library for mapping the functions of brain knowledge learning, updating and memory storage; providing a scheduling cloud for mapping the functions of brain pre-judgment, scheduling coordination and external extension; responding to a request for judging a to-be-judged event, judging the to-be-judged event through scheduling at least one layer of pools in the multi-layer pool by adopting the scheduling cloud. The invention provides a novel mode for judging the to-be-judged event. In this way, the judgingprocess of the to-be-judged event is more accordant with the thinking of people. The accuracy of judging the to-be-judged event is improved, so that the user experience is improved.

technical field [0001] The present disclosure relates to the fields of artificial intelligence and computer technology, and in particular to a brain mapping-based event determination method and device, storage medium, and electronic equipment. Background technique [0002] With the rapid development of science and technology, artificial intelligence is being applied more and more in all walks of life to bring more convenience to daily life. For example, in the medical field, artificial intelligence doctors can judge patients' diseases. [0003] At present, the emergence of artificial intelligence doctors requires medical personnel to inquire and collect the patient's basic information, symptom information, examination and other information, and input the information obtained from the inquiry into the artificial intelligence doctor.
